While you can define the relationships top down from the strategic goals to the portfolio, program, and project in Strategy IQ, which we collectively refer to as the delivery initiatives, some organizations do it from the bottom up by associating the initiative with the appropriate goals.

Here are a few rules to remember when associating or disassociating a benefit or a goal:
- Each initiative, whether a project, program or a portfolio, can be associated with multiple goals and benefits, while still adhering to the rule that a specific benefit can be associated with only a single initiative.
- You will use Portfolio IQ, if you are associating a portfolio or program with a goal, and you will use Project IQ to associate a project.
- Benefits and goals would be associated or disassociated using the same process using the Benefits register within the delivery initiatives – portfolio, program, and project.
Associate a benefit or a goal
- Ensure you are in Project IQ (if associating a Project) or Portfolio IQ (if associating a Portfolio or Program).

They will provide you with a working knowledge of the Project IQ and Portfolio IQ areas respectively. - Select and open the appropriate project (or portfolio or program).
- Select the Goals (or Benefits) tab.
- Select + Add Existing Strategic Goals (or Benefits) to the selected initiative.
- Search for and select the appropriate Goal (or Benefit).
- Click Save & Close.
Disassociate a benefit or a goal
- Ensure you are in Project IQ (if associating a Project) or Portfolio IQ (if dis-associating a Portfolio or Program).
- Select and open the appropriate project (or portfolio or program).
- Select the Goals (or Benefits) tab.
- Select the Goal (or Benefit) you wish to disassociate.
- Select Remove.
- Click Save & Close.
